Transaction 664ed0359c8c66e09c82117205bd930101a93af4f353000686bf681690cf6038
1 Input
1 Output
-
664ed0359c8c66e09c82117205bd930101a93af4f353000686bf681690cf6038:0
- value
- 9531096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 211ac5485309c726b244a169d7111eaaf9cda58f OP_EQUAL
- address
- 34i4HvvNTEhg4v292ibYrE3NF7b2sZR3iN